What distinguishes a psychologist, a therapist, and a counsellor?


Therapists, psychologists, and counsellors are all licensed mental health professionals. Typically, psychologists Keep a doctoral degree in many countries. The terms “therapist” and “counsellor” are somewhat synonymous, though therapists usually meet the expense of long-term mental health care, whereas counsellors come taking place with the grant for short-term care focusing upon a specific area, such as marriage, career, or academic issues.

While the terms “psychologist,” “therapist,” and “counsellor” are often used interchangeably, they pull off have clear meanings within the ring of mental health. Let’s expand on these distinctions:

    1. Psychologists: In most countries, psychologists are professionals who withhold a doctoral degree (PhD, PsyD, or EdD) in psychology. They are trained in a variety of therapeutic techniques and have extensive knowledge in psychological theory, human behavior, and developmental processes. They are moreover equipped to conduct psychological testing, which can be useful in diagnosing a range of mental health disorders. Their research knack often supplements their practice, allowing them to stay informed practically the latest advancements in mental health care. Clinical psychologists tend to play a role with individuals who have more aggressive mental health conditions or require comprehensive, long-term treatment.


 

    1. Therapists: The term “therapist” is a broader category that includes professionals who are trained to manage to pay for a variety of mental health services. This can augment clinical psychologists, but along with encompasses licensed clinical social workers (LCSWs), marriage and relatives therapists (MFTs), and licensed professional counselors (LPCs), among others. They give therapeutic services to individuals, couples, and groups. While a therapist might specialize in positive areas, they typically have enough money long-term care and encourage clients navigate a variety of life’s challenges, such as trauma, grief, stress, or association issues.


 

    1. Counsellors: While “counsellor” and “therapist” are often used interchangeably, in some contexts, a counsellor might take in hand to a professional who provides more targeted, short-term support. Counsellors often focus on helping individuals concurrence with specific excitement issues or transitions, such as career changes, academic struggles, or marriage problems. This could upset giving advice, providing tools and strategies for managing certain situations, or helping clients set and achieve specific goals. Some counsellors may have specialized training in a particular area, such as substance abuse, school counseling, or career counseling.


Despite these distinctions, the most important factor in well-to-do therapy is often the relationship between the client and the professional, regardless of the specific title or degree. It’s crucial to locate a mental health professional taking into consideration whom you feel amenable and who has the indispensable expertise to put taking place to you later your specific challenges. Always make distinct any professional you pick is licensed in their dome and, if applicable, in your jurisdiction.

Which therapy type suits me best?


The therapy type that best suits an individual hinges upon several factors, including their primary excuse for seeking therapy, their preferred duration (certain therapy types have a unconditional number of sessions, while others are open-ended), and their personality and preferences—some might favor a more structured approach. For many individuals, various types of therapy might be a great match.

Choosing the best type of therapy often depends upon various factors related to your personal situation, therapeutic goals, and even individual personality. Some factors to judge include:

    1. Primary Reason for Seeking Therapy: Different therapeutic approaches may be better suited to address determined issues than others. For instance,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) is often recommended for issues such as demonstration and depression, as it focuses on changing negative thought patterns and behaviors. Trauma-focused therapies past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ing (EMDR) or Trauma-Focused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(TF-CBT) can be more beneficial for individuals dealing afterward the effects of trauma.

    1. Preferred Duration: The length of therapy can depend on the therapeutic entry chosen. For example, Solution-Focused Brief Therapy (SFBT) tends to be short-term and goal-oriented, often concluding within 5 to 10 sessions. On the other hand, psychodynamic therapy, which focuses on exploring deeper, unconscious processes, can extend beyond several months to years, as it often requires more get older to delve into these rarefied issues.

    1. Personality and Preferences: Some people may pick therapy types that are more structured and directive, such as CBT, where the therapist guides the session in the same way as specific exercises and homework assignments. In contrast, others might thin towards more exploratory methods considering psychoanalytic therapy, which allows for open-ended sessions and client-led conversations.

    1. Comfort next Self-disclosure: Certain therapeutic modalities have an effect on more self-disclosure than others. For example, psychoanalytic and humanistic approaches often assume a great deal of personal postscript and ventilation about one’s past, whereas CBT may focus more upon current thoughts and behaviors.

    1. Cultural and Personal Beliefs: Your cultural background and personal beliefs also produce a result a significant role in determining what type of therapy is best suited to you. Therapies subsequent to Narrative Therapy or Culturally Sensitive Therapy accept into account the cultural and social context of the individual, respecting their unique worldview and experiences.

    1. Readiness for Change: Some therapies, like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) or Motivational Interviewing, are specifically designed to put stirring to people who are ambivalent or resistant to change. These therapies play up building drive and adherence to change.

    1. Support Systems: The presence or malingering of a robust withhold system can also disturb the unusual of therapy. For instance, if you have supportive family or friends, Family Systems Therapy or Group Therapy can provide other resources and insights.


Remember, it’s not unusual for therapists to integrate different methods based upon the client’s individual needs, making therapy a in fact personalized experience. The most important thing is to find a therapist who can tailor their edit to encounter your unique needs and circumstances. Don’t hesitate to ask a potential therapist approximately their log on and whether it’s a good fit for your situation.

Is online therapy less costly than face-to-face therapy?


Most therapists charge the thesame fee for remote therapy as they accomplish for in-person therapy—though clients might nevertheless find this cost-effective if it reduces their commuting expenses. Health insurance plans often come stirring with the allowance for equivalent coverage for unfriendly and in-person therapy; indeed, they are legally required to do as a result in many areas. Text-based or on-demand therapy apps may be less expensive than usual one-on-one psychotherapy; however, this approach may be less full of life and is unlikely to be covered by insurance.

The cost of online therapy not in accord of face-to-face therapy can vary, and the decision to choose one greater than the supplementary often comes alongside to exceeding just the session fees. Here are some factors to consider:

    1. Therapist’s Fee: While many therapists encounter the thesame rate for online and in-person sessions, this isn’t always the case. Some therapists may offer condensed rates for online sessions to account for the edited overhead costs.

    1. Travel Costs and Time: A significant advantage of online therapy is that it eliminates the dependence for travel. This can be particularly beneficial if you stir in a rural area, have a successful schedule, or approach mobility challenges. The child support and mature saved on commuting can make online therapy a more cost-effective option.

    1. Insurance Coverage: In many regions, health insurance providers are required to cover online therapy (teletherapy) in the thesame way they cover in-person therapy. However, insurance coverage can change widely, so it’s crucial to uphold this subsequently your provider. Also, remember that some types of online therapy, such as text-based or on-demand therapy apps, may not be covered by insurance.

    1. Online Therapy Platforms: Some online therapy platforms find the child maintenance for services at a humiliate cost than received one-on-one therapy, offering subscriptions that allow for more frequent communication. These facilities can enlarge messaging, video calls, or a inclusion of both. However, the shortened cost may reflect a trade-off in the setting or intensity of care, as these sessions might be shorter, less personalized, or provided by less approved practitioners.

    1. Efficacy of Therapy: It’s also essential to adjudicate the effectiveness of the therapy. While many studies have shown that online therapy can be just as in force as in-person therapy for many conditions, this might not be the dogfight for everyone. The effectiveness can depend on factors taking into account the nature of your concerns, your comfort subsequently technology, and how much you value face-to-face interaction. If you find online therapy less effective, any cost savings might not be worth it.


In conclusion, while online therapy might give some cost advantages such as edited travel expenses and possibly belittle session rates, it’s important to consider extra factors with insurance coverage, the type of online therapy, and its effectiveness for you. Also, it’s crucial to check that any therapist or online therapy platform you’re in the space of is licensed and reputable to ensure that you’re getting the environment of care you deserve.
